So, for the past several updates of Origin I've had this issue on my Windows 10 computer, I've already submitted a few bug reports on the matter but I suppose this is a good way to show the problem more in depth. When attempting to start the latest version of Origin, or even the installer therefor, I am given an abnormally long start up time, and when the window does finally appear it's a solid white window with nothing in it (see attached image origwhite.png). This stays there for over ten minutes before, in the case of the installer bringing me to the install page, or in the case of the regular application bringing me to another solid white screen and then the login screen with an error message saying "Origin login is currently unavailable" and offering to let me log in in offline mode; if I actually run the installer through it also brings me to that same glitched login screen when the install allegedly completes.
After logging in, which again results in the program taking significantly more time to load than it should, I am once again given nothing but a solid white window that shows nothing but the top bar indicating I am offline.
Here's a list of suggested fixes I've tried that have not worked:
restarting
clearing Origin cache
reinstalling Origin
changing install settings when reinstalling Origin
repairing the vcredist installations
using the full installer rather than thin
removing superfluous USB storage devices
granting exceptions for Origin in my antivirus and firewall
disabling proxies
reinstalling Windows completely(!)
changing the Origin installation location
changing networks
trying different compatibility modes
This issue has been going on for quite some time now, but I actually did find one solution that worked until earlier this week: reinstalling an older version of Origin that lacks this error. That workaround works perfectly fine, it suffers from neither the slow loading nor the white screens, and I was perfectly content using that until earlier this week when it started forcibly setting itself to offline mode after a few minutes of operation, kicking me out of any games in progress and refusing to go back online, telling me that I had to update to the newer, broken version.
As far as I am aware the only potential fix I have not tried is making changes to my computer's hardware, something I am not willing to do for an error that previous editions of Origin do not have with this system.
